[Bug 57427] New: 1.0 TLDs are missing from -compat jar

The jar for taglibs-standard-compat does not contain the TLDs for the 1.0 tags
that it supports. This prevents the libraries from being used.

This jar is intended to allow the user to utilize a different implementation of
EL such as the one from the container. However, the missing TLDs prevent that.

A work-around may be to package the TLDs directly into /WEB-INF.
